My husband and I ordered our wedding cake from Batch. We began talking to them in January for our October ceremony. The owner wasn’t super responsive via email but they do offer vegan cakes and their process was supposed to be easy. We reached out September 14th for our October 14th wedding to make sure they still had our info and we were good to go. Our payment was due October 7th. I called on September 30th to pay by phone ahead of time to get it taken care of. I confirmed our information, told the person I spoke to that a friend was picking it up, asked if they needed her name or anything. They said as long as she knew our names it would be no issue. Well, my friend gets to the bakery at 10am of my wedding day and they told her that they called me multiple times to get payment but I never answered so they never made my cake but claims they threw my order form away so they couldn’t verify my information either. They told my friend unless I had a receipt there was nothing they could do and were far from apologetic. She calls me and luckily I asked for an email receipt and was able to provide that for them. Meanwhile I’m panicking not sure what we’re gonna do about a cake. They were able to bake the cake and get it to us but the person in store kept having to go back and forth on the phone with the owner and didn’t seem to want to help and we didn’t get an apology despite trying hard on our end to not have to worry about it.
